Water Polo Finishes 5-0 At Claremont Convergence
10/6/2007 12:00:00 AM | Men's Water Polo
The Waves (17-3, 01) finished their two-day match play 5-0 by defeating Pomona-Pitzer 17-2 in the last game of the Convergence.
